lwhhszx hace 2 años
padre
commit
cc0c8f31ac

+ 2 - 2
PAS/src/main/java/cn/cslg/pas/service/OutInterfaceService.java

@@ -199,14 +199,14 @@ public class OutInterfaceService {
         return Objects.requireNonNull(httpClient.newCall(request).execute().body()).string();
     }
 
-    public String importAssoReportPatentNo(Integer reportId, String patentNo) throws IOException {
+    public String importAssoReportPatentNo(Integer reportId, String patentNo,String name) throws IOException {
         OkHttpClient httpClient = new OkHttpClient.Builder()
                 .pingInterval(400, TimeUnit.SECONDS) // 设置 PING 帧发送间隔
                 .connectTimeout(300, TimeUnit.SECONDS)//设置连接超时时间
                 .readTimeout(300, TimeUnit.SECONDS)//设置读取超时时间
                 .build();
         Request request = new Request.Builder()
-                .url(RMSUrl + "/api/report/api/compare/addSingle?reportId=" + reportId + "&patentNo=" + patentNo)
+                .url(RMSUrl + "/api/report/api/compare/addSingle?reportId=" + reportId + "&patentNo=" + patentNo+"&name="+name)
                 .get()
                 .build();
         return Objects.requireNonNull(httpClient.newCall(request).execute().body()).string();

+ 1 - 0
PAS/src/main/java/cn/cslg/pas/service/outApi/PatentStarApiService.java

@@ -210,6 +210,7 @@ public class PatentStarApiService {
         });
     }
 
+
     public Map<String, Object> patentStarSearchApi(PatentStarListDto patentStarListDto) throws IOException {
        try {
            String formQuery = patentStarListDto.getCurrentQuery();

+ 3 - 2
PAS/src/main/java/cn/cslg/pas/service/upLoadPatent/PantentQueueService.java

@@ -347,9 +347,10 @@ public class PantentQueueService {
                     if (queueData.getTask().getProjectId() != null && !queueData.getTask().getProjectId().equals(0)) {
                         //与专题库关联入库
                         uploadPatentToDBService.uploadAssoThemaPat(queueData.getUploadParamsVO(), queueData.getTask().getProjectId());
-                    } else if (queueData.getTask().getReportId() != null && !queueData.getTask().getReportId().equals(0)) {
+                    }
+                    else if (queueData.getTask().getReportId() != null && !queueData.getTask().getReportId().equals(0)) {
                         //与报告关联入库(调用报告系统接口)
-                        outInterfaceService.importAssoReportPatentNo(queueData.getTask().getReportId(), queueData.getUploadParamsVO().getPatent().getPatentNo());
+                        outInterfaceService.importAssoReportPatentNo(queueData.getTask().getReportId(), queueData.getUploadParamsVO().getPatent().getPatentNo(), queueData.getUploadParamsVO().getPatent().getName());
                     }
 
                     ProjectImportPatentVO projectImportPatentVO = JsonUtils.jsonToPojo(queueData.getTask().getPramJson(), ProjectImportPatentVO.class);